INDIAN RIVER COUNTY - For two Sundays in August, dining at Dockside Grille in Vero Beach, including drinks and take-outs, will benefit the Homeless Family Center.
Those who dine from Aug. 5-19, for breakfast, lunch or dinner from 9 a.m. to close and present a flyer to a server, Dockside Grille will generate a 10 percent donation of the total bill back to the center.
This promotion includes hosting special events such as a birthday parties, anniversaries, business dinners, banquets and cocktail parties. It is valid on events booked by Aug. 19 and good until Nov. 19.
All menu selections and drinks are included except happy hour food and drink specials, which run from 3-6 p.m. It cannot be combined with any other discounts.
Dockside Grille is located at 41 Royal Palm Pointe in Vero Beach.
The Homeless Family Center is a nonprofit organization committed to changing lives one family at a time.
The center, which provides emergency and transitional shelter for homeless families from Indian River, St. Lucie, Martin and Okeechobee counties, is a partner agency of United Way, the Treasure Coast Homeless Services Council and the Indian River County Children's Services Advisory Committee.
